On September 20, 1955

  1. 1955 The Treaty on Relations between the USSR and the GDR is signed.

    Agreement to station Soviet Army troops in East Germany

    The Treaty on Relations Between the USSR and GDR was a treaty between the Soviet Union and German Democratic Republic, commonly known as East Germany, signed on 20 September 1955. The treaty became the legal basis for the Group of Soviet Forces in Germany, and its successor, the Western Group of Forces to maintain its presence in Germany following the end of the Soviet occupation.
